Minx is a medium- to long-haired black cat. She has a bit of white on her chest and pretty green eyes. She is very friendly and loves to be picked up and cuddled. She also loves tummy rubs.
Minx has a foster-brother cat whom she loves to follow around, and she tries to entice him to play with her. She loves when her human plays with the feather on a stick so she can run, jump, and "attack" it. She loves little stuffy toys she can carry around in her mouth.
Minx also has a medium-size gentle dog as a foster-brother! She isn't bothered by him or his barking at all!
Minx would love to join a family with another kitty who can be a snuggle buddy and playmate for her.

Contra Costa Humane Society's Adoption Policy
CCHS has animals available for adoption through a number of different avenues.  Many of our kittens and all dogs are cared for in loving foster homes until they are adopted.  Teenage, adult, senior and special-needs cats reside at Kitty Corner, an on-site, private cat shelter where cats are allowed to free-roam at all times, lounge in sunny windows and on comfy cat towers, and play to their heart's galore.  Similarly, we also have animals available for adoption through our Re-Homing Assistance Program, where we help to advertise animals that caregivers are no longer able to keep. If you are interested in meeting any of the animals listed on our website, please complete an adoption application unless otherwise noted! Our business office and Kitty Corner are located at 171 Mayhew Way, Suite 101 in Pleasant Hill, CA 94523. Kitty Corner houses adult, senior, and special-needs cats (sometimes teenage kittens).
